RFC 1483-MER Static
Configuration
To configure your WAN settings for an RFC 1483-MER Static
Configuration, perform the following steps:
Forwarding Mode: Routing
1
Select
Create
from the
PVC Name Edit Mode
drop-down menu. If no
WAN interface has previously been configured, the field will already be
set to
Create
.
2
Enter a name for your PVC (Permanent Virtual Circuit) in the
PVC Name
field. This is the name for the WAN you are configuring. The PVC is the
circuit that will be used to form the connection between the LAN and
WAN sides of the OfficeConnect Gateway.
3
Select
RFC 1483-MER
from the
WAN Protocol
drop-down menu.The
WAN Configuration page will dynamically change as shown in the
following illustration.
